2014 ML350 New tires, what's your pick?

Hi Everyone,
I'm in need of new tires, of course I want nice quiet smooth ride. I bought a set of Michelin Defenders LTX and they are smooth and relatively quiet, but they feel like a light truck tire on the car. I am thinking of returning them. I am now thinking the Michelin Premier LTX, what are your thoughts? Any other brand I should try? I do have DWS on my E350 and like them but want to try something else.

How about Nokians for Winter (R2-SUV), any comment on that would be good also, I do have an extra set of Rims

Replaced my OEM Conti's with the Michelin Premier LTX at 35,000 miles in August. Since I have only had them on for 4,000 miles, I can't speak about durability; but I can attest that at 36psi, they are quiet, handle well and do not hydroplane like the Conti's did. So far, I am pleased with this choice.

I have a 2012 ML 350 4Matic, gas, with standard suspension.

I'm having the dealership put Pirelli Scorpion Verde V rated 107 XLs on our 2012 before we take delivery. I have had these tires on a Land Rover and a Volvo XC70 previously. They do well in the snow, handle well in dry weather and last a long time. People have complained about them being louder than the OEM tires on their SUVs but I rotate my tires every 5k to help prevent that. So far so good. In the past I have found that Dunlap really wasn't great in any category, Michelin had a couple of good individual models/lines and Toyo did terrible in the snow and Nokian and Bridgestone make great snow tires (no news there).
